Ecological and Economic Efficiency of Recycling of Fiber-Containing Waste Into Heat- and Sound-Insulating Materials in the Republic of Tatarstan
Abstract
The technology of waste recycling based on the processing of straw of cereal crops into a heat-insulating material in terms of efficiency, which is not inferior to well-known brands, but significantly more economical in production.
